Lin Shen, a modern corporate slave, accidentally travels back to 1984 to Linjiatun, a village at the foot of the Xiaoxing'an Mountains in Northeast China, while staying up late watching an agricultural documentary. The original owner was a sickly boy mocked by the whole village for 'being afraid of pigs,' but Lin Shen wakes up to a 300-jin wild boar crashing through the fence! He grabs a firewood knife and uses modern wilderness survival skills to kill it with one precise strike, instantly becoming a legend. But trouble follows: the village bully tries to steal his wild boar cubs, the accountant withholds his family's relief grain, and even his own second uncle wants to take his two mu of thin land. However, Lin Shen smiles and uses his 'modern trump cards': modifying an old radio from the scrap yard into a walkie-talkie to contact merchants outside the mountains, buying lambs for mountain free-range breeding, and convincing the village chief to try growing early-maturing watermelons from the south... When the first watermelon sells for 1.2 yuan (a fortune back then), those who once called him 'unserious' can only stare at his new brick house and the villagers crowding his yard begging for cooperation, their faces burning with shame. Meanwhile, Zhou Xiuqin, the village beauty hiding in the crowd, clutches the sweater she secretly knitted, blushing at the memory of Lin Shen saving her and saying: 'From now on, I'll take you to make big money and live a good life.'
